Why does the AIQ Score favor UEC over AVGO?

The composite weights Quality at 30%, Value at 30%, Momentum at 25% and Risk Resilience at 15%. UEC leads Momentum by 37 points; AVGO leads Quality by 36 points; UEC leads Value by 4 points. Where the two split, the factor with the larger weight carries the result.

Which has stronger momentum, AVGO or UEC?

UEC on the Momentum factor, by 37 points. Momentum carries 25% of the AIQ composite. It has documented persistence over three- to twelve-month horizons, which makes it a timing input rather than a reason to hold something indefinitely.

How this comparison is scored

The Algovestiq AIQ Score composites four factors — Quality (30%), Value (30%), Momentum (25%) and Risk (15%). Sentiment is reported separately as SentimentPulse and is not folded into the composite. Scores refresh every trading day, and this page regenerates from the latest snapshot rather than being written once.

The verdict names a leader, states how broadly six independent evidence groups agree, and rates how durable that conclusion is given the score gap, its recent trajectory and the current signal state on both names.
